[python]パンダ研究ノート(7)文字列処理

ここに画像の説明を挿入

import pandas as pd

fpath = './ant-learn-pandas-master/datas/beijing_tianqi/beijing_tianqi_2018.csv'
rating = pd.read_csv(fpath)
print(rating)

1、交換

rating['bWendu'] = rating.loc[:, 'bWendu'].str.replace("℃", "")

2、含む

各値が条件を満たすかどうかのブール値を返します

a = rating.loc[:, 'bWendu'].str.contains("1")

ここに画像の説明を挿入
3.それが数であるかどうかを判断し、複数の処理を連鎖させます

a = rating.loc[:, 'bWendu'].str.replace("℃","").str.isnumeric()

4.正規表現をサポートします

a = rating.loc[:, 'bWendu'].str.replace("[C]","")

おすすめ

転載: blog.csdn.net/Sgmple/article/details/113061973